Nike and Adidas Compete for Brand Dominance at the World Cup

Date:

The global sportswear giants Nike and Adidas are locked in a high-stakes competition for brand dominance as the World Cup tournament intensifies. Both companies have invested heavily in sponsoring key national teams and star athletes, aiming to capture the attention of billions of football fans worldwide. This intense commercial rivalry drives significant merchandise sales and shapes the global athletic apparel market, with both brands leveraging on-pitch performances and digital campaigns to secure consumer loyalty.

  • Nike and Adidas are the dominant kit sponsors for the majority of the national teams participating in the tournament.
  • Adidas benefits from its long-standing status as an official FIFA partner, providing the official match balls and referee apparel.
  • Nike has aggressively expanded its roster, sponsoring several high-profile contenders and individual marquee players to challenge its rival’s traditional dominance.
  • The commercial success of each brand is closely tied to the on-field progression of their sponsored teams, which directly impacts the retail sales of replica jerseys.

France 24 is a French state-owned international news television network based in Paris, aimed primarily at an overseas market. It broadcasts around the clock in French, English, Arabic, and Spanish, providing rolling news and current affairs with a distinctively French perspective on global events. Publicly funded by the French government, the network focuses on international debate, culture, and diplomacy, serving as France's equivalent to global broadcasters like BBC World News or DW.
